Transaction 26809fe8e760f4232a728dc03296e3c9229a7b93996c7d0dd35d1daca4d9d0e9

1 Input
2 Outputs
  • 26809fe8e760f4232a728dc03296e3c9229a7b93996c7d0dd35d1daca4d9d0e9:0
  • value  3927000
    address  37ZE7a5sG2YL9iB2d2edKiaJkWWCMvXqni
  • 26809fe8e760f4232a728dc03296e3c9229a7b93996c7d0dd35d1daca4d9d0e9:1
  • value  20227550
    address  187t8H3rWnjvMegKnEjrZdXWBWj23dy1Gw